Problem: completion: cannot configure completion functions with
'complete'
Solution: add support for setting completion functions using the f and o
flag for 'complete' (Girish Palya)
This change adds two new values to the `'complete'` (`'cpt'`) option:
- `f` – invokes the function specified by the `'completefunc'` option
- `f{func}` – invokes a specific function `{func}` (can be a string or `Funcref`)
These new flags extend keyword completion behavior (e.g., via `<C-N>` /
`<C-P>`) by allowing function-based sources to participate in standard keyword
completion.
**Key behaviors:**
- Multiple `f{func}` values can be specified, and all will be called in order.
- Functions should follow the interface defined in `:help complete-functions`.
- When using `f{func}`, escaping is required for spaces (with `\`) and commas
(with `\\`) in `Funcref` names.
- If a function sets `'refresh'` to `'always'`, it will be re-invoked on every
change to the input text. Otherwise, Vim will attempt to reuse and filter
existing matches as the input changes, which matches the default behavior of
other completion sources.
- Matches are inserted at the keyword boundary for consistency with other completion methods.
- If finding matches is time-consuming, `complete_check()` can be used to
maintain responsiveness.
- Completion matches are gathered in the sequence defined by the `'cpt'`
option, preserving source priority.
This feature increases flexibility of standard completion mechanism and may
reduce the need for external completion plugins for many users.
**Examples:**
Complete matches from [LSP](https://github.com/yegappan/lsp) client. Notice the use of `refresh: always` and `function()`.
```vim
set cpt+=ffunction("g:LspCompletor"\\,\ [5]). # maxitems = 5
def! g:LspCompletor(maxitems: number, findstart: number, base: string): any
if findstart == 1
return g:LspOmniFunc(findstart, base)
endif
return {words: g:LspOmniFunc(findstart, base)->slice(0, maxitems), refresh: 'always'}
enddef
autocmd VimEnter * g:LspOptionsSet({ autoComplete: false, omniComplete: true })
```
Complete matches from `:iabbrev`.
```vim
set cpt+=fAbbrevCompletor
def! g:AbbrevCompletor(findstart: number, base: string): any
if findstart > 0
var prefix = getline('.')->strpart(0, col('.') - 1)->matchstr('\S\+$')
if prefix->empty()
return -2
endif
return col('.') - prefix->len() - 1
endif
var lines = execute('ia', 'silent!')
if lines =~? gettext('No abbreviation found')
return v:none # Suppresses warning message
endif
var items = []
for line in lines->split("\n")
var m = line->matchlist('\v^i\s+\zs(\S+)\s+(.*)$')
if m->len() > 2 && m[1]->stridx(base) == 0
items->add({ word: m[1], info: m[2], dup: 1 })
endif
endfor
return items->empty() ? v:none :
items->sort((v1, v2) => v1.word < v2.word ? -1 : v1.word ==# v2.word ? 0 : 1)
enddef
```
**Auto-completion:**
Vim's standard completion frequently checks for user input while searching for
new matches. It is responsive irrespective of file size. This makes it
well-suited for smooth auto-completion. You can try with above examples:
```vim
set cot=menuone,popup,noselect inf
autocmd TextChangedI * InsComplete()
def InsComplete()
if getcharstr(1) == '' && getline('.')->strpart(0, col('.') - 1) =~ '\k$'
SkipTextChangedIEvent()
feedkeys("\<c-n>", "n")
endif
enddef
inoremap <silent> <c-e> <c-r>=<SID>SkipTextChangedIEvent()<cr><c-e>
def SkipTextChangedIEvent(): string
# Suppress next event caused by <c-e> (or <c-n> when no matches found)
set eventignore+=TextChangedI
timer_start(1, (_) => {
set eventignore-=TextChangedI
})
return ''
enddef
```

Neovim is a project that seeks to aggressively refactor Vim in order to:
- Simplify maintenance and encourage contributions
- Split the work between multiple developers
- Enable advanced UIs without modifications to the core
- Maximize extensibility
See the Introduction wiki page and Roadmap for more information.
Features
- Modern GUIs
- API access from any language including C/C++, C#, Clojure, D, Elixir, Go, Haskell, Java/Kotlin, JavaScript/Node.js, Julia, Lisp, Lua, Perl, Python, Racket, Ruby, Rust
- Embedded, scriptable terminal emulator
- Asynchronous job control
- Shared data (shada) among multiple editor instances
- XDG base directories support
- Compatible with most Vim plugins, including Ruby and Python plugins

Install from source
See BUILD.md and supported platforms for details.
The build is CMake-based, but a Makefile is provided as a convenience. After installing the dependencies, run the following command.
make CMAKE_BUILD_TYPE=RelWithDebInfo
sudo make install
To install to a non-default location:
make CMAKE_BUILD_TYPE=RelWithDebInfo CMAKE_INSTALL_PREFIX=/full/path/
make install
CMake hints for inspecting the build:
cmake --build build --target help
lists all build targets.build/CMakeCache.txt
(orcmake -LAH build/
) contains the resolved values of all CMake variables.build/compile_commands.json
shows the full compiler invocations for each translation unit.

Project layout
├─ cmake/ CMake utils
├─ cmake.config/ CMake defines
├─ cmake.deps/ subproject to fetch and build dependencies (optional)
├─ runtime/ plugins and docs
├─ src/nvim/ application source code (see src/nvim/README.md)
│ ├─ api/ API subsystem
│ ├─ eval/ Vimscript subsystem
│ ├─ event/ event-loop subsystem
│ ├─ generators/ code generation (pre-compilation)
│ ├─ lib/ generic data structures
│ ├─ lua/ Lua subsystem
│ ├─ msgpack_rpc/ RPC subsystem
│ ├─ os/ low-level platform code
│ └─ tui/ built-in UI
└─ test/ tests (see test/README.md)
License
Neovim contributions since b17d96 are licensed under the
Apache 2.0 license, except for contributions copied from Vim (identified by the
vim-patch
token). See LICENSE for details.
